While I've been spending an awful lot of time recently working on cleaning out my recently passed…read morefather's home, I knew it was supposed to rain today and decided to skip visiting Putnam County in favor handling some legal and logistical issues. This included a visit to the Post Office to complete my father's change of address (Boy, that's a loaded concept when the person has actually passed). While a change of address can typically be handled online or via a simple form, when the person is deceased it actually requires an in-person visit. Since I was on the northwest side of Indy, I opted to visit my old stomping grounds and went to the New Augusta branch at 84th and Moller Road. This is a large branch in an office/industrial park area. I won't quite say it's hidden, however, it's definitely set apart a bit. This branch offers self-service kiosks, PO boxes, gift cards, greeting cards, domestic money orders, inquiry money orders, mailing, pickup, business, and biometric services (by appointment). They do not offer passport services here. As you pull in, you go left if you just want to drop off mail. To the right, is a nice-sized parking lot with a couple accessible spots. There's an appropriate ramp, of course. As this is an older branch, there's no automatic doors. There are actually three doorways to get to the area for help/customer service - two at the main entrance and one separating this area from the self-serve areas. The counter is also not ADA friendly as it's much higher. The good news is that the employee I worked with was pretty awesome. She helped me with the form, got the necessary copies (if you're doing a change of address because of death, you'll typically need at least the death certificate and likely the probate order indicating you're the personal representative for the estate - this is why it has to be done in person).
